About the job Talent Sourcer Job Title: Talent Sourcer 6-month contract with strong possibility to extend Location: Chicago, Illinois (on-site 2 days/week) 40-hour work week Pay : $30-38/hour About the Role The Talent Sourcer will support our clients Talent Acquisition team by proactively identifying, engaging, and pre-qualifying candidates for hard-to-fill and ageing requisitions. This role partners closely with recruiters to build strong candidate pipelines and accelerate time-to-fill across priority roles. The Sourcer focuses on front-end talent identification and engagement, allowing recruiters to concentrate on stakeholder management, interviews, and offers. Key Responsibilities - Candidate Sourcing & Engagement Proactively source passive and active candidates using LinkedIn, internal talent pools, referrals, market mapping, and professional networks. Execute sourcing strategies aligned to recruiter-led Recruitment Strategy Meetings (RSMs) and ageing requisitions. Conduct initial outreach with phone as the primary first-touch method, followed by email as needed, leveraging the clients Employee Value Proposition. Pre-Qualification & Pipeline Management Pre-screen candidates to assess skills, experience, career goals, and interest level prior to recruiter handoff. Maintain accurate candidate records within the clients recruiting systems and talent communities. Build and maintain pipelines for current and future hiring needs, including referral generation. Recruiter Partnership Partner closely with recruiters to prioritize ageing requisitions. Provide regular updates on sourcing activity, candidate flow, and market insights. Support recruiters during periods of high requisition volume. Process & Compliance Follow the clients recruiting processes, data privacy standards, and sourcing best practices. Ensure accurate source tracking and documentation. Qualifications - Required 2+ years of experience in talent sourcing or recruiting. Strong experience sourcing passive candidates using LinkedIn and Boolean search techniques. Excellent candidate engagement skills. Ability to man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ment. Qualifications - Preferred Experience in large, global organizations or RPO environments. Familiarity with Workday or similar ATS platforms. Experience supporting manufacturing, engineering, or corporate roles. What Success Looks Like Increased qualified candidate flow for ageing requisitions. Reduced sourcing burden for recruiters. Faster slate development and improved candidate quality. Fluid thanks you for your interest in this opportunity.
